Schneller, transparenter und persönlicher Bewerbungsprozess – Details
Der schnelle und transparente Einstellungsprozess der IU

Software Engineer (m/f/d) PHP

Tech & Engineering
München + 8 weitere Standorte
Festanstellung
Vollzeit
Berufserfahrene

Software Engineer (m/f/d) PHP

Wenn Du Dich für diese Stelle bewirbst, hast Du die Möglichkeit, Deinen bevorzugten Standort aus den folgenden anzugeben: München, Berlin, Dresden, Frankfurt am Main, Hamburg, Köln, Leipzig, Magdeburg, Rostock


Join us to make education accessible for all!

Strengthen our Engineering Team in full-time (40 hrs./week) as Software Engineer (m/f/d) within Germany or UK remotely or at one of our office locations.

This role focuses on developing and maintaining high-performance, event-driven distributed systems and managing the student contract lifecycle.

Our Stack

  • PHP, Vue.js 3, Tailwind CSS, Vite, Kafka, AWS, Docker, DataDog, GitLab, DDD

Don’t worry if you don’t have experience with every technology in our stack—if you’re passionate about learning and growing, we encourage you to apply!

Your tasks

  • Building and shaping a new end-to-end service focused on student contract lifecycle management—from contract creation through lifecycle events like recognition of prior learning, leave semesters, etc., to data transfer into Workday.
  • Developing our high-performance event-driven distributed system using microservices and microfrontends.
  • Collaborating with fellow engineers, product managers, UX, QA, DevOps, and other stakeholders.
  • Monitoring and troubleshooting the system, utilizing various tools and metrics to ensure high availability and performance.
  • Developing and maintaining up-to-date documentation, best practices, and standards.

Your Profile

  • Solid experience in PHP development.
  • First experience with event-driven architecture and ideally some exposure to event streaming platforms like Kafka or message brokers like RabbitMQ.
  • Familiarity with cloud platforms (preferably AWS) and experience with container technologies such as Docker.
  • Good understanding of web technologies and familiarity with topics like website performance, accessibility, semantics, and code quality.
  • Experience in component development using modern web frameworks such as Vue, Svelte, SolidJS, or React.
  • Enthusiasm for technical concepts and software architecture.
  • Team player with good communication skills.
  • Independent, goal-oriented, and structured way of working.
  • Ownership of tasks and eagerness to grow and contribute to the bigger picture.

We offer

  • Be you at IU: We support and encourage you to achieve your personal and professional goals. After all, your satisfaction is an essential part of a positive and productive environment.
  • Work where you want…: Digitalization is part of our DNA. Therefore, you can decide for yourself which place sparks the most productivity in you. Do you love working from home? No problem! Do you want to work abroad for a while? Our WorkFlex benefit makes it possible.
  • …and flexible in time: It’s your job: We trust you and give you the greatest possible freedom to organize yourself.
  • Use your own technology: You can freely choose your equipment. Everyone has their own preferences when it comes to hardware and IDE.
  • Take your knowledge to a new level: Where, if not with us? Enjoy free access to all our e-learning platforms. In addition, we finance a complete technology degree of your choice.
  • Sustainably to your destination: The 9-euro ticket is back! We subsidize your DeutschlandTicket, so you only pay €8.70 per month. Do you prefer to travel by bike? Then a JobRad might be something for you. This way, you are mobile both professionally and privately and do something good for the environment.
  • 33 days of relaxation: Breaks are important! In addition to 30 flexible vacation days per year, we also give you an extra day off on your birthday and free days on Christmas Eve and New Year’s Eve.

IU International University of Applied Science (IU) is Germany’s largest university of applied science – and we are not just an excellent choice for studying, but also an outstanding Great Place to Work®! As an Edutech company, we rely on state-of-the-art technology and data-driven approaches. That’s why AI-driven voice assistants and other GPT systems have long become part of our daily work routine, helping us to focus on exciting projects.

Here at IU over 4,000 employees are dedicated to making a difference.

Become part of our Engineering team! We’re passionate, competitive, open to all things new – and we love data. We live to code anything that makes IU students and IU services better.

Actions speak louder than words: We cherish our „Culture of Everyone“ and would like to take this opportunity to empathize that we do not tolerate discrimination towards any race, gender, religion, age, sexual orientation or disability. We welcome you as you are and look forward to nurturing our diverse community at the IU!

Unser Recruiting-Team ist für Dich da

Hast Du noch Fragen? Unser Recruiting-Team hilft Dir gerne weiter - individuell und persönlich.
Luisa_Keck
Fermin_Martinez
Kata Jarosz
Marina Meissner
Ronja Kaiser
Die IU hat mich in meinem Vorstellungsgespräch gefragt, was ich machen möchte – und heute mache ich es. Ich habe die Freiheit, so zu arbeiten, wie ich will; das zu entwickeln, was ich für nötig halte; und ich werde bei meiner Entwicklung voll unterstützt.
Studenten mit Brille
Anton Stangl
Software Developer
Der Standort
Surfer Eisbachwelle
München
Unser wunderschöner Münchener Campus befindet sich in Berg am Laim, unser Business- und Mission-Center in der Schwantalerhöhe. Hier werden die bahnbrechenden Produkte und Services der IU konzipiert, entwickelt und gemanagt.
Über das Team
Tech & Engineering Student
Tech & Engineering
Wir gehen über Grenzen hinaus, stellen Bestehendes infrage, tun, was noch nie getan wurde – und verbinden Menschen und Bildung miteinander. So ticken wir in Tech & Engineering bei der IU Internationalen Hochschule (IU).

Wir entwickeln eine digitale Form der Bildung, die überall zugänglich ist – egal, wo man sich befindet. Unsere Lösungen sind mobil, ständig und an jedem Ort verfügbar. Durch den Einsatz von KI, NLP, Big Data Analytics, IoT, Cloudplattformen und Softwareentwicklung führen wir die digitale Transformation der Bildung an.
Unsere Werte
#1

Hilf gemeinsam Großes zu erreichen

Wir suchen als Team nach der besten Lösung und haben Spaß dabei – ohne großes Ego und ohne Politik.
#2

Sei mutig und setze auf Risiko

Wir treffen mutig unsere Entscheidungen und gehen dabei wohlkalkulierte Risiken ein.
#3

Sei offen für Innovation

Wir suchen permanent nach neuen Ideen, um unsere Angebote an die Kunden noch besser zu machen.
#4

Gib alles, um alle anderen zu stärken

Wir unterstützen uns gegenseitig in unserer Entwicklung, damit alle die beste Version von sich selbst werden können.
#5

Entwickle Dein growth mindset

Wir wollen uns permanent verbessern – in allem, was wir tun. Und wir arbeiten hart dafür. Tag für Tag.
#6

Achte auf Dein Zeitmanagement

Wir setzen Dinge schnell, pragmatisch, effektiv und zielorientiert um.
#7

Gib unseren Kunden Priorität

Unsere Kunden kommen immer an erster Stelle – bei allem, was wir tun.

Bewerbung jetzt abschicken

Gleich geschafft: Wir brauchen noch ein paar Angaben zu Deiner Person und möchten Dich bitten Deinen Lebenslauf hochzuladen. Ein Anschreiben ist nicht erforderlich – es sei denn, Du möchtest Dich für eine Professur bewerben. Nach Erhalt Deiner Bewerbung setzen wir uns baldmöglichst mit Dir in Verbindung.
Lebenslauf (PDF, max. 5 MB)*
    Weitere optionale Dokumente (PDFs, je max. 5 MB)
      Es ist ein Fehler aufgetreten. Bitte lade die Seite neu und versuche es erneut.
      *Pflichtfelder
      Danke für Deine Bewerbung
      Wir haben Deine Bewerbung erhalten und freuen uns, dass Du an einer Zusammenarbeit mit uns interessiert bist. Unser Recruiting Team prüft nun sorgfältig Deine Unterlagen und wird sich in Kürze mit Dir in Verbindung setzen.
      Nächste Schritte
      Bewerbung erfolgreich
      Wir kontaktieren Dich in Kürze
      1. Interview

      Tech & Engineering FAQs

      Kann ich remote für das Tech-Team arbeiten?
      Ja, klar! Wir legen großen Wert auf Flexibilität und unterstützen Remote Arbeiten zu 100% wo immer möglich.
      Kann ich mich auf mehrere Stellen bewerben?
      Auf jeden Fall! Bewirb Dich für jede Stelle separat und gemeinsam suchen wir den Job aus, der am besten zu Dir passt.
      Was solltest Du mitbringen, um bei der IU erfolgreich zu sein?
      Wir suchen aufgeschlossene Teamplayer, die konventionelle Weisheiten gerne hinterfragen und sich in flachen Hierarchien gegenseitig unterstützen. Genau Dein Ding? Dann bewirb Dich unter www.iu-careers.com/jobs
      Wie viele Tage bezahlten Urlaub bekomme ich im Jahr?
      Alle Mitarbeitende mit einer 5-Tage-Woche haben Anspruch auf 30 Tage bezahlten Urlaub im Jahr. Zusätzlich haben alle Mitarbeitenden an ihrem Geburtstag immer bei uns frei. Dein Geburtstag liegt dieses Jahr auf einem Wochenendtag? Dann ist der nächste Arbeitstag für Dich frei!
      SYNTEA Icon